Dr Manie Opperman

Dentist

GDC: 70239
QUALIFICATION: BCHD PRETORIA 1983

Dr Manie Opperman graduated from the University of Pretoria, South Africa, in 1983. After completing two years of compulsory national service, followed by two years serving as a Captain in the army, he began his career in private practice. In 1987, he acquired his first dental practice in Centurion, South Africa, where his passion for implantology and minor oral surgery grew. His commitment to innovation led to the development of an implant system in 1992.

In 1994, Dr Opperman relocated to England. After focusing initially on general dentistry, he deepened his expertise in implantology and dental occlusion, the precise science of how teeth meet and function. In 2000, he became the principal dentist at Hockerill Dental Practice, where he continued to refine his skills in general dentistry.

Dr Opperman has a special interest in minor oral surgery and implantology, working extensively with the BICON implant system, known for its reliability and patient-focused design.
